YSRCP's Adjournment Motion For a Debate On Cash For Vote
24 Mar 2017 7:10 PM
Velagapudi: YSR Congress Party on Friday sought an adjournment and a debate on the Cash For Vote scam under rule No 63 in the Assembly.
The YSRCP insisted that the question hour be suspended and the issue be taken up for discussion. Assembly speaker Kodela Sivaprasara Rao disallowed the motion forcing the YSRCP members to troop into the well and raise slogans. The speaker adjourned the house thrice.
TDP MLAs have hurled abuses at YSR Congress Party throughout the Assembly session on Friday.
Soon after the house assembled for the day, the TDP leaders resorted to verbal abuse. TDP MLA Bonda Umamaheswara Rao continuted to hurl abuses at YSRCP chief YS Jagan Mohan Reddy.
He was supported by MLA Chintamaneni Prabhakar. These were countered by Chandragiri MLA and YSRCP leader Chevireddy Bhaskar Reddy.
